Omar Avila

Actor Profile
Omar Avila

Movie Credits

Omar Avila has appeared in 2 movies.

These include The Punisher and Bad Boys II.

TV Credits

Omar Avila has appeared in 2 TV Series.

These include House and Pushing Daisies.